PHEVs work differently. A PHEV also uses a gasoline engine, an electric motor, and a battery. But its electric motor is more powerful. A plug-in hybrid battery is much larger — closer to one found in a pure electric vehicle (EV) like a Tesla. The government’s plan to reduce vehicle emissions requires local councils to use a range of measures such as: Changing road layouts at congestion and air pollution pinch points.My round estimate is that my car gets 45mpg, where a similar non-hybrid car would do 35mpg. So the 100k miles used maybe 2200 gallons instead of 2900. So if dollars are your only concern, it probably isn't worth it. If advancing society towards a less carbon-dependent future is important, then it could well be worth the extra cost.Are Hybrid Cars Worth It? ...
